> The GPS interface control document IS-GPS-200D defines message type 32 
> on page 145 (Figure 30-5) and pages 175-178.
> The message contains the parameters necessary to calculate UT1 (Earth 
> rotation angle) when UTC is known.
> Does anyone know of a readily available GPS receiver that makes these 
> parameters accessible to the user?
